An RV dump station, also known as a sanitary dump station for RVs, is a facility where RV owners can dispose of their waste. To find an RV dump station, you can use various resources such as websites, apps, or directories. These resources provide information about the location, hours of operation, and any fees associated with using the dump station. Some websites even offer user reviews and ratings to help you choose the best option. When using an RV dump station, it is important to follow the posted guidelines and instructions to ensure proper disposal and prevent any damage or contamination.

This used to be a nice, clean, scenic lake with a great swimming beach. As of June 2024 the drought has supposedly ended in Lancaster County, but the water level remains as low as last summer. The beach is completely unusable, overrun by weeds, and large areas of the lake that used to be underwater are now home to tall plants. Maybe someday the lake will be restored to its former glory, or at a minimum perhaps Game & Parks will give some kind of a status update as to what is going on with this lake.
